Indigenous-Owned Businesses on Yuin Country

SHARE

Here on Yuin Country, we’re lucky to have a strong and growing community of Indigenous-owned businesses, spanning tourism, arts, food, wellbeing, land care, and more.

These businesses are a vital part of our region’s culture and economy, reflecting the deep knowledge, creativity, and connection to Country held by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ander people.
